div.sethref是一個CSS選擇器,用于選擇HTML文檔中帶有class屬性為"sethref"的div元素。通過使用這個選擇器,我們可以在CSS中對具有該類別的div元素進行樣式設(shè)計和操作。下面將通過幾個代碼案例來詳細(xì)解釋div.sethref的用法和功能。
案例一: 假設(shè)我們有一個HTML文檔,其中包含多個div元素,并且其中的某些div元素具有class屬性為"sethref"。我們希望為這些特定的div元素設(shè)置一個特殊的背景顏色。可以通過以下CSS代碼實現(xiàn):
案例二: 除了樣式設(shè)計外,div.sethref還可以用于選擇特定的div元素,并在JavaScript中進行進一步的操作。例如,我們希望通過點擊具有class屬性為"sethref"的div元素,顯示一個彈出窗口。可以通過以下代碼實現(xiàn):
以上是關(guān)于div.sethref的使用簡介和幾個代碼案例的詳細(xì)解釋。通過這個CSS選擇器,我們能夠在樣式設(shè)計和JavaScript操作中更精確地選擇和操作特定的div元素。希望這些例子對您有所幫助!
案例一: 假設(shè)我們有一個HTML文檔,其中包含多個div元素,并且其中的某些div元素具有class屬性為"sethref"。我們希望為這些特定的div元素設(shè)置一個特殊的背景顏色。可以通過以下CSS代碼實現(xiàn):
p { background-color: yellow; } <br> div.sethref { background-color: pink; }在上述代碼片段中,我們?yōu)樗衟元素設(shè)置了黃色的背景顏色。然后,通過div.sethref選擇器,為具有class屬性為"sethref"的div元素設(shè)置了粉色的背景顏色。這樣,在我們的HTML文檔中,所有帶有class屬性為"sethref"的div元素將顯示為粉色背景。
案例二: 除了樣式設(shè)計外,div.sethref還可以用于選擇特定的div元素,并在JavaScript中進行進一步的操作。例如,我們希望通過點擊具有class屬性為"sethref"的div元素,顯示一個彈出窗口。可以通過以下代碼實現(xiàn):
<script> var sethrefDivs = document.querySelectorAll("div.sethref"); <br> for (var i = 0; i < sethrefDivs.length; i++) { sethrefDivs[i].addEventListener("click", function() { window.alert("You clicked a div with class 'sethref'!"); }); } </script>在上面的代碼中,我們使用document.querySelectorAll方法選擇所有具有class屬性為"sethref"的div元素,并將其存儲在sethrefDivs變量中。然后,使用循環(huán)為每個div元素添加一個click事件監(jiān)聽器。當(dāng)用戶點擊任何一個具有class屬性為"sethref"的div元素時,將顯示一個彈出窗口,其中包含一條消息。
以上是關(guān)于div.sethref的使用簡介和幾個代碼案例的詳細(xì)解釋。通過這個CSS選擇器,我們能夠在樣式設(shè)計和JavaScript操作中更精確地選擇和操作特定的div元素。希望這些例子對您有所幫助!